United Hatzalah Celebrating 10 Years of Lifesaving Thanks to Innovative Technology
United Hatzalah, Israel’s largest independent, non-profit, fully volunteer Emergency Medical Service (EMS) organization provides fast, free emergency medical first-response throughout the country. The organization has approximately 3,000 volunteers from throughout the spectrum of Israeli society, who all share a single … Continue reading
